The objective of this study was to formulate once-a-day extended-release (ER) pellet system of imidafenacin (IDN), a recently approved urinary antispasmodic agent with twice-a-day dosing regimen. The sugar sphere pellets were firstly layered with IDN and hypromellose and then coated with Eudragit RS (copolymers of acrylic and methacrylic acid esters), employed as a release modifier, using a fluid-bed coater. The possibility to compress ordinary paper into tablets was systematically investigated in this study. Results proved that tablets can be made from paper, independent of the type of paper used. The tablets appear shiny and with a smooth surface. The pharmaceutical quality was acceptable, i.e. all tablets fulfilled the requirements for tablets according to the European Pharmacopeia. Formulation of gliclazide in the form of extended- release tablet in 30 and 60 mg dosage forms was performed using hypromellose (HPMC K4M) as a retarding agent. Drug-release profiles were investigated in comparison with references Diamicron MR 30 and 60 mg tablets.

Functional EUDRAGIT® polymers offer a wide variety of formulation options, which allow formulation design tailored to specific therapeutic requirements or the API characteristics. By combining different polymer types or applying several coating layers, almost every desired release profile can be achieved.

Polymersomes are enclosed membrane nanostructure of amphiphilic block copolymers that currently have attracted great interest because of their structural analogies with living organelles and potential applications as nanosized reactors or drug delivery systems.

The study demonstrates the application of QbD based on historical data for a product at a later development stage – retrospective QbD (rQbD). More specifically, it is investigated the root-cause for the observed slower drug release in Orodispersible Films (ODFs) during storage.

A promising approach to improve the solubility of poorly water-soluble drugs and to overcome the stability issues related to the plain amorphous form of the drugs, is the formulation of drugs as co-amorphous systems.
